The Bahama Banks: A Shallow Water Wonderland
Next up, we're heading to the Bahama Banks, a vast underwater plateau that’s a haven for shallow-water adventures. This area is characterized by its crystal-clear, turquoise waters and is perfect for snorkeling, shallow-water diving, and exploring marine life. The Bahama Banks is one of the world's largest underwater plateaus, and it’s a unique geographical feature. It’s significantly shallower than the surrounding ocean, often with depths ranging from just a few feet to around 20 feet. These shallow waters allow sunlight to penetrate, creating incredible visibility and supporting a thriving ecosystem. The shallow depth also makes it ideal for beginners and families with children to enjoy the beauty of the sea safely. The calm waters of the Bahama Banks are in stark contrast to the more turbulent Atlantic, offering a tranquil and idyllic experience. The clear water here is ideal for spotting colorful fish, coral reefs, and other marine creatures, making it a fantastic destination for snorkeling and diving. Some of the best islands to explore in the Bahama Banks include:
- Andros: Home to the third-largest barrier reef in the world, perfect for diving and snorkeling.
- Exuma Cays: Famous for its stunning sandbars, crystal-clear waters, and the swimming pigs.
- Bimini: Known for its proximity to Florida and its incredible diving spots, including the Sapona shipwreck.

The Gulf Stream: A Marine Highway
Let’s dive into the Gulf Stream, not technically a sea, but a powerful ocean current that plays a significant role in shaping the Bahamian waters. The Gulf Stream, originating in the Gulf of Mexico, flows through the Bahamas and contributes to the warm, clear waters and rich marine life that the region is known for. This major current acts as a marine highway, transporting nutrients and marine life throughout the area. It significantly influences the weather patterns and the marine environment, bringing warm water that creates a favorable climate and supports a wide variety of species. The Gulf Stream contributes to the Bahamas' warm climate, clear waters, and vibrant marine ecosystem. This current's strong flow also makes the Bahamas a prime location for deep-sea fishing, as it attracts a large number of pelagic species. The Marine Highway is responsible for the incredible biodiversity of the Bahamas. The Gulf Stream’s influence extends beyond just the water. It also helps to keep the air temperatures moderate and creates the ideal conditions for the growth of coral reefs, which support a diverse array of marine life. The Gulf Stream also aids in the migration of marine animals, bringing in everything from whales and dolphins to various species of fish. From secluded beaches and secret coves to hidden underwater wonders, there is an entire world to explore. Some of the hidden gems of the Bahamas include:
- Conch Sound, Andros: Visit the world's third-largest barrier reef and discover the vibrant marine life.
- Dean's Blue Hole, Long Island: Dive into the world's deepest blue hole and explore the underwater cave systems.
- The Abaco Islands: Explore the untouched beauty of these islands, with their quiet beaches, charming settlements, and the opportunity to experience the true island life.
- Eleuthera: Discover the pink sand beaches, the Glass Window Bridge, and the historic settlements.
- The Exuma Cays Land and Sea Park: A protected area known for its pristine waters, abundant marine life, and the iconic swimming pigs.
